ViewVC Help
View File | Revision Log | Show Annotations | Download File | Root Listing
root/jsr166/jsr166/src/test/loops/SimpleLockLoops.java
(Generate patch)

Comparing jsr166/src/test/loops/SimpleLockLoops.java (file contents):
Revision 1.5 by jsr166, Thu Oct 29 23:09:08 2009 UTC vs.
Revision 1.7 by jsr166, Thu Sep 16 03:57:13 2010 UTC

# Line 58 | Line 58 | public final class SimpleLockLoops {
58              barrier.await();
59              if (print) {
60                  long time = timer.getTime();
61 <                long tpi = time / ((long)iters * nthreads);
61 >                long tpi = time / ((long) iters * nthreads);
62                  System.out.print("\t" + LoopHelpers.rightJustify(tpi) + " ns per lock");
63 <                double secs = (double)(time) / 1000000000.0;
63 >                double secs = (double) time / 1000000000.0;
64                  System.out.println("\t " + secs + "s run time");
65              }
66  
# Line 77 | Line 77 | public final class SimpleLockLoops {
77                  int x = 0;
78                  int n = iters;
79                  while (n-- > 0) {
80 <                    synchronized(lock) {
80 >                    synchronized (lock) {
81                          int k = (sum & 3);
82                          if (k > 0) {
83                              x = v;

Diff Legend

Removed lines
+ Added lines
< Changed lines
> Changed lines